Zindagi Na Milegi Dobara is one of Zoya Akhtar’s most successful films. Zoya had helmed the film back in 2011 and it emerged as one of the biggest films of the year. ZNMD continues to have a cult following, with many hoping that the cast reunites for a sequel. Now, Zoya has revealed some interesting details about the film’s iconic ending featuring Hrithik Roshan, Abhay Deol and Farhan Akhtar running away from bulls.

Speaking to The Juggernaut, Zoya said, “The film ended for me when the boys are running and the poem says ‘Toh zinda ho tum.’ Ritesh (Sidhwani) was like, ‘You have to give it an end,’ and I was like this is the end. So then we had focus screenings and people came out and asked us if they were dead… A lot of people asked, ‘Did they die? What happened?'”

“I’m like, ‘Is this a joke?’ Then I had to shoot that song (Suraj Ki Baho Main) and put that song so that people know that they’re not dead. I was like, ‘Can we write: for the stupid people?’ He said, ‘No, you can’t put this out’, but that’s what happened. You can’t leave open ends in Indian commercial cinema. They want to know, even with Dil Dhadakne Do they were like did he meet Farah? I’m like, dude…,” Zoya added.

She recently confirmed that Hrithik Roshan, Farhan Akhtar and Abhay Deol are interested in reuniting for Zindagi Na Milegi Dobara 2. “Yes, this (ZNMD 2 discussions) comes up all the time, and everybody is interested.” She added, “That movie meant a lot to us. So, if we find that soul for part two, we will make it. We don’t want to do it just for money. When the audience comes to watch the second part, they will have a certain expectation, and we must give it to them; otherwise, they won’t be happy,” Zoya told ANI.
